Patriots Training Camp: Brissett and Maye Shine, Zappe Struggles for Reps

Veteran Jacoby Brissett and rookie Drake Maye lead the offense while Bailey Zappe competes for a roster spot.

  • Jacoby Brissett and Drake Maye excelled in red-zone and two-minute drills, showing strong performances.
  • Bailey Zappe, who started eight games for the Patriots, did not take any reps during the latest practice session.
  • Rookie Joe Milton III received limited reps, positioning him ahead of Zappe on the depth chart.
  • Wide receivers are emerging, with notable performances from DeMario Douglas and K.J. Osborn.
  • Kendrick Bourne, recovering from a torn ACL, is close to returning and could boost the team's morale.
